容器网络监控如何支持跨云平台?
在当今的云计算时代,跨云平台的应用已经成为企业数字化转型的重要趋势。容器网络监控作为保障应用稳定运行的关键技术,如何支持跨云平台成为众多企业关注的焦点。本文将深入探讨容器网络监控在跨云平台中的应用,分析其面临的挑战及解决方案。
一、跨云平台应用背景
随着云计算技术的不断发展,越来越多的企业开始采用多云战略,将业务部署在多个云平台上。跨云平台应用具有以下优势:
- 提高业务连续性:通过将业务部署在多个云平台,可以降低因单点故障导致的服务中断风险。
- 优化成本:根据业务需求,灵活选择不同云平台的资源,降低整体成本。
- 提升性能:利用不同云平台的特性,实现业务性能的优化。
然而,跨云平台应用也带来了一系列挑战,其中之一便是容器网络监控的难题。
二、容器网络监控面临的挑战
- 异构网络环境:不同云平台的网络架构、协议、性能等方面存在差异,导致容器网络监控难以统一。
- 数据采集难度大:跨云平台应用涉及多个云平台,数据采集难度大,难以实现实时监控。
- 监控数据孤岛:不同云平台的监控数据难以整合,导致监控效果不佳。
三、容器网络监控支持跨云平台的解决方案
- 统一监控平台:构建一个统一的容器网络监控平台,支持多云环境下的监控需求。该平台应具备以下特点:
- 支持多种云平台:兼容主流云平台,如阿里云、腾讯云、华为云等。
- 统一的监控指标:定义统一的监控指标,方便用户在不同云平台间进行对比分析。
- 可视化展示:提供直观的监控界面,方便用户快速了解业务状态。
- 数据采集与整合:
- 采用代理模式:在每个云平台上部署代理节点,负责采集本地容器网络数据。
- 数据传输与存储:将采集到的数据传输至统一监控平台,并进行存储和管理。
- 数据清洗与处理:对采集到的数据进行清洗和处理,确保数据准确性和一致性。
- 跨云平台监控策略:
- 自定义监控策略:根据业务需求,自定义监控策略,实现针对不同云平台的个性化监控。
- 自动化报警:根据监控指标,自动触发报警,及时发现问题。
- 可视化分析:提供可视化分析工具,帮助用户深入挖掘业务数据,优化业务性能。
四、案例分析
某企业采用跨云平台架构,将业务部署在阿里云、腾讯云和华为云上。为了实现容器网络监控,该企业选择了某知名监控厂商的产品。通过该产品,企业实现了以下目标:
- 统一监控:实现了对三个云平台上容器网络的统一监控,方便了运维人员的管理。
- 实时报警:及时发现网络故障,降低了业务中断风险。
- 性能优化:通过监控数据,优化了业务性能,提升了用户体验。
五、总结
容器网络监控在跨云平台应用中扮演着重要角色。通过构建统一监控平台、数据采集与整合、跨云平台监控策略等手段,可以有效解决跨云平台应用中的监控难题。未来,随着云计算技术的不断发展,容器网络监控将更加智能化、自动化,为跨云平台应用提供更加可靠的保障。
猜你喜欢:网络流量采集